Description

From puberty through to the menopause, a woman's reproductive organs undergo constant change due to the processes of the ovarian and menstrual cycle, pregnancy and aging.

Unfortunately, the organs of the female reproductive system may often be affected by disease and injury. Many women suffer from gynecologic disorders, such as pol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S), endometriosis, uterine fibroids, vaginitis, and menstrual disorders.

Epidemiological studies show that lifestyle, diet and nutritional habits can be important risk factors in the context of gynecological diseases.

This book gathers the latest knowledge regarding nutrition therapy for the treatment of gynecological diseases, which will offer valuable insights into how diet as a whole, nutraceuticals, nutrients, dietary patterns, phytochemicals and specific dietary components can serve as preventive and/or therapeutic compounds.
